Originally Posted by Big Pistons Forever
The B1 windshield thread got me thinking off some of the ridiculous goings on in the supply system I have experienced

1) When I was the deck officer on a small ship the Buffer informed me that the ship to buoy shackle was cracked. I told him to go to the base supply depot and get a new one. He called me from the depot saying they would not give him one because they only had one and if they gave it to us they would have none. I went down to explain that this part only fit our ship so we were the only ones who would ever want it, but they were adamant that the rules required them to always have one in stock. In the end it was simpler to get the fleet maintenance facility to weld repair the old shackle over forcing the supply system to cough up the part.
I have no doubt too that, after it having been on the shelf for a number of years and never having issued that part, the supply chain deemed it no longer required and disposed of it.
